FILMINDIA VOL. 3 No. 9 The songs of Ashalata have been taken by the "play-hack" system, which process I have explained earlier in these columns. From: N.H.Z. (Allahabad). In which of the two arts— direction and acting—is Mr. Barua more competent? He is competent in both, but more so in direction. Do you believe that the Bombay Talkies are acting rather unwisely in producing pictures so quickly? I don't because they are maintaining a top heavy expense every month, and if they are ever to submit a plus report to their directors, they must put some more speed in their production. The greatest mistake which they are, however, committing is in concentrating on a single artiste. Why no Indian film producers ever care to make short educational films? Because most of them are themselves uneducated and they can only produce something which they themselves can understand. From: B.S.B. (Bangalore). I wonder why the Directors themselves act in the pictures? Perhaps to establish new traditions in aping. From: Bekhabar (Shajahanpur). Where is Shanta Kumari of "Khune Nahaq" fame? She is keeping house and cooking meals for Recordist Y. S. Kothare at Poona. A wise girl to keep the home fires burning. From: J. S. S. (Bareilly). What languages can the following Directors speak and understand easily:— 1. Mr. M. Bhavnani, 2. Mr. Chandulal Shah. 3. Mr. P. C. Barua, 4. C. M. Luhar. As far as 1 know these people speak the following languages, but I can't say whether they understand what they speak. 1. English and Sindhi, 2. Gujerathi and English, 3. Bengali and English, 4. Gujerathi and English. What sort of relation exists between the hero and the heroine after studio hours? Does it depend upon the discretion of the director or upon the will of the heroine? I can't understand what exactly you mean, as your question is not clear and precise. However, if you mean "good relations" they will always depend upon the will of the heroine — she beiny a woman who always has the last word. Why do actresses in general become fatter and ugly, within the first few years of their career/ Because they live on the producers? How old is Miss Padma these days and excuse me for bad manners to ask how much is she getting? A woman is as old as she looks, and this girl must be about twenty three years old. By the time you read this she will be a month older. As regards her salary she just gets what she deserves, provided she gets it at all. From: N.D.G. (Katni). In most of the Ran jit pictures I find the repetition of plot, dialogues and scenes, which strikes me as rather monotonous. Why do these people not try to improve by trying new stories and new talent for their pictures? When people suffer from monomania, they become slaves to a certain idea. If you tell them to improve they just won't listen. As they are paying for the game, why should we worry. From: A.R.M. (Ajmere). I have all the qualifications of an actor and I want to know how I can join the cinema line as such. Different men different methods! I shall tell you how some of the present day actors have got into it and you may choose your own way. Method No. 1. This kind almost usually has a good looking sister or a closely related beautiful female to chaperon and sponsor the claims of the candidate. Thus prosecuted, the producer becomes an easy catch. Method No. 2. After finding a tin god from amongst the distributors — mind you, he must have a big voice which can be heard a mile away — all that is to be done is to act as his ward and throw yourself on his tender mercies if necessary by cleaning utensils in his house and giving him a massage at late hours in the night, till this person takes you to a producer and dumps you as a birthday present on him. I know two such actors who have climbed to fame effectively this way. Method No. 3. Knocking about and around the studio for months and throwing disarming smiles all about till you get one in the eye of some director who looks at you suspiciously for months. One of the primary things you will have to do for him is to buy his 'pan' and knock about with his love letters. Method No. 4. Get into the house of some successful heroine, and if you catch her eye for your looks climb to stardom with the help of her sari. Method No. 5. Write a straightforward application to the studio proprietor and wait for (lie reply that never comes. 16
